Page 1 of 2 PUBLIC NOTICES. ****** DISSOLUTION OF PARTNERSHIP. Commercial Buildings, Workington, 18th April, 1899. Dear Sir (or Madam)- We beg to give you notice that the Partnership heretofore subsisting between us, the undersigned. Mordaunt LAWSON and Richard TILTMAN, carrying on Business together at Commercial Buildings, Workington, as Iron Merchants, under the style or firm of "LAWSON & TILTMAN," has this day been dissolved by mutual consent. Yours truly, Mordaunt LAWSON Richard TILTMAN ****** A Hound Dog Trail Will Be Held At The Woolpack Inn, Eskdale On Friday, May 5th, 1899 Entrance, 2s 6d Each.
